Regular Season Round 35: McMaster - Lakehead 92-82
Date: February 16, 2013
We could consider it a predictable result in the game between close teams when third ranked Marauders (13-8) beat second-ranked Thunderwolves (14-7) in Hamilton, ON 92-82 on Saturday. The game was mostly controlled by Marauders. Thunderwolves was better in second period 20-17.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. They made 28-of-34 free shots (82.4 percent) during the game, while Thunderwolves only scored six points from the stripe. Marauders forced 21 Thunderwolves turnovers. Thunderwolves were plagued by 27 personal fouls down the stretch. Guard Aaron Redpath (193) orchestrated the victory by scoring 20 points. Guard Adam Presutti (188) contributed with 15 points and 4 assists for the winners. Forward Joey Nitychoruk answered with 18 points (on 9-of-10 shooting from the field) and guard Greg Carter (178-90) added 11 points, 5 rebounds and 5 assists in the effort for Thunderwolves.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Both coaches tested many bench players which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. Marauders maintains third place with 13-8 record having just three points less than leader UBC. Loser Thunderwolves keep the second position with seven games lost. Both teams do not play next round, which will be an opportunity for some rest.
